Starting at Douro Marina

The tour begins at Douro Marina, specifically at pontoon C, which is straightforward to reach by Uber or Bolt (around 7 EUR from Porto’s city center). The comfort of the meeting point makes for a stress-free start, especially if you’re arriving after a day of sightseeing. Once onboard, you immediately feel the sense of exclusivity; unlike larger, crowded river cruises, this boat is reserved just for your group.

The Itinerary and Key Stops

The boat departs with a relaxed vibe, setting out to explore the Douro river. The guides, like Miguel and Guillermo, are praised for their knowledge and friendly demeanor. They’re eager to share stories about Porto’s bridges, the river’s history, and local tidbits—turning a simple cruise into a personalized tour.

  • Arrábida Bridge: The first major landmark you pass beneath. This bridge, with its impressive concrete arch, is a favorite for many. As you glide underneath, guides might share facts about its construction and significance. Megan mentions that Miguel allowed them to experience the river at their own pace, which adds a layer of comfort and flexibility.

  • Cais de Gaia & Port Wine Cellars: Passing by the Gaia side, you get a glimpse of the famous Port wine cellars. While not a tasting tour, the views of these historic warehouses are captivating, especially as the boat drifts close to the shore.

  • Ribeira Square: From the water, this lively neighborhood reveals itself with its colorful buildings and bustling vibe, offering a fresh perspective compared to walking tours.

  • Bridges Galore: The D. Luís I bridge, Infante D. Henrique, D. Maria Pia, São João, and Freixo bridges all come into view. Guides tend to share stories about each structure’s design and history, making the experience richer than just looking at pretty steel and stone.

  • Douro Estuary Nature Reserve: As the boat turns toward the estuary, the scenery shifts from urban to serene. The guides highlight the natural beauty and tranquillity of this protected area. Guests like elcomptab have noted how peaceful and beautiful the estuary feels—an unexpected highlight.

What’s Included and What’s Not

For $250, you get exclusive use of the boat, fuel, insurance, and a welcome drink—value that feels appropriate given the personalized nature. However, food isn’t included, so if you’re looking for a full dining experience, you’d need to bring snacks or plan a separate meal. The tour does not include hotel pickup or drop-off, which means you should plan your transportation ahead of time.

Practical Considerations

  • The tour lasts 2 hours, making it perfect for a quick escape or a pre-dinner drink with views.
  • It’s not suitable for large luggage or pets, focusing on comfort and safety.
  • The meeting point is easy to reach, but be aware it’s not suitable for those with mobility impairments.
  • Weather can impact the tour—it’s not held under extreme atmospheric conditions—and guides will reschedule if needed.

FAQ

Porto: Private Boat Tour in Douro River - FAQ

How long does the tour last?
It lasts approximately 2 hours, giving enough time to see the main sights without feeling rushed.

Where do I meet the tour?
At Douro Marina, pontoon C, which is easily accessible by Uber or Bolt and close to Porto’s city center.

Is the tour private or shared?
It’s a private experience limited to your group of up to four people, ensuring a personal and relaxed environment.

Are food and drinks included?
Only a welcome drink is provided. Food is not included, so consider bringing snacks if desired.

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.

Is the tour suitable for children or mobility-impaired guests?
It’s not suitable for those with mobility impairments, and children are welcome, but keep in mind the restrictions on large luggage and pets.

How accessible is the meeting point?
Douro Marina is easy to reach via Uber or Bolt, and the area is straightforward to navigate.

What is the price per person?
The total cost is $250 per group, up to four people, making it a good value for a private experience.

Are guides bilingual?
Yes, guides speak Portuguese and English, ensuring clear communication and storytelling.
